About East Potomac Park

The East Potomac Park Golf Course is a public golf course that was established in 1921. It is located on Hains Point, a peninsula situated between the Potomac River and the Washington Channel, in the heart of Washington DC. The course boasts three 18-hole courses, a 9-hole course, and a driving range. It is known for its scenic views of both the National Mall and the Potomac River and is a popular spot for golfers of all skill levels. The course has hosted numerous championships and events, including the D.C. Open and the Capital City Open. It is managed by the National Park Service and is one of the busiest golf courses in the country.
